Learn more about Ferrara

Renaissance walls encircle Ferrara's historic centre where you can explore Este Castle and the magnificent Cathedral with its marble façade. Rent bikes to follow ancient ramparts, then visit Palazzo dei Diamanti's distinctive diamond-shaped marble blocks and impressive art collection.

Top reasons to visit Ferrara

  • Historic Centre: Ferrara boasts a UNESCO-listed historic centre, filled with captivating architecture and rich history that transports visitors back in time.
  • Ferrara Cathedral: This stunning example of Romanesque architecture is a must-visit, showcasing intricate designs and a serene atmosphere.
  • Charming Piazzas: Explore lively piazzas where you can experience local culture, enjoy delicious cuisine, and interact with friendly locals.
  • Outdoor Activities: Ferrara offers beautiful parks and scenic surroundings, perfect for outdoor enthusiasts and families alike.

Things to do in Ferrara

Shopping

In Ferrara, explore local boutiques and artisanal shops offering unique gifts and souvenirs. Don't miss the weekly Mercato di Ferrara for fresh produce and handmade crafts. If you're up for a drive, visit the nearby Shopville Le Gru for a larger selection of international brands.

Recreation

In Ferrara, the Terme di Giunone offers a tranquil spa experience with thermal baths and wellness treatments designed to rejuvenate the body and mind. For outdoor relaxation, explore the expansive Parco Massari, where you can take leisurely strolls amidst lush greenery and historic monuments.

Adventure

In Ferrara, explore the historic city centre by cycling along its ancient walls, offering a unique perspective of the Renaissance architecture. Visit the nearby Po Delta Park for kayaking and birdwatching, immersing yourself in the diverse wildlife and stunning landscapes of this UNESCO Biosphere Reserve.

Nightlife

Ferrara's nightlife offers a charming blend of vibrant bars and cosy cafés. Enjoy a drink at the atmospheric Caffè dell’Opera or dance the night away at the lively Bar L’Incontro. For a more relaxed vibe, unwind at the intimate Enoteca Ristorante La Bottega del Vino.

Find the best attractions in Ferrara

Ferrara, nestled in Emilia-Romagna, is perfect for family, outdoor, and city-themed holidays. Visitors can immerse themselves in its rich culture by exploring historic palaces, charming churches, and lively piazzas. Key attractions include the historic centre of Ferrara and the stunning Ferrara Cathedral. For a comfortable stay, consider the best hotels in the heart of Ferrara, ensuring a memorable experience in this captivating Italian city.

  • Palazzo dei Diamanti: This stunning palace, renowned for its unique diamond-shaped façade, offers a glimpse into the Renaissance era. Visitors can enjoy its exquisite art exhibitions and the tranquil gardens that enhance its cultural ambiance.
  • Ferrara Cathedral: A magnificent example of Romanesque architecture, Ferrara Cathedral features intricate sculptures and stunning frescoes. The serene atmosphere invites reflection as you explore its richly decorated interiors and the historical significance of the site.
  • Piazza Ariostea: This lively square serves as a social hub, surrounded by beautiful buildings and vibrant cafes. It's an ideal spot to immerse yourself in local culture while enjoying the views and perhaps witnessing a community event.

Best time to go to Ferrara

The best time to visit Ferrara is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ly sunny with no r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January40.1°F (4.5°C)No R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
February43.5°F (6.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
March49.8°F (9.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
April56.7°F (13.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
May64.2°F (17.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
June73.4°F (23.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
July78.3°F (25.7°C)Light RainSunnyAverageAverage
August78.1°F (25.6°C)Light RainSunnyAverageSlightly Low
September70.0°F (21.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
October61.0°F (16.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November51.1°F (10.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
December41.7°F (5.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age

What should I see while I'm in Ferrara?
Cultural venues include Cathedral Museum, Palazzo dei Diamanti and Palazzo Massari. Notable for its historic sites, landmarks like Castle Estense, Ferrara Cathedral and Walls of Ferrara are not to be missed. Natural beauty is on display at Botanical Garden and Herbarium, Piazza Ariostea and Parco Urbano G. Bassani. Take a look at what more there is to see and do in Expedia's Ferrara guide.
How should I get around Ferrara?
If you want to travel outside the area, take a train from Ferrara Station, Pontelagoscuro Station or Coronella Station. If you want to venture out around the area, you may want a rental car in Ferrara for your journey.
What's the seasonal weather like in Ferrara?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 24°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 7°C. Average annual precipitation for Ferrara is 867 mm.
